V Shape back shifting weight
V Shape back shifting weight is an advanced spiral stabilization exercise; it assumes you have the basic series covered. Execution: shifting weight. Equipment: rope.
Starting position: Stand with your back facing the rope handle, the feet are parallel, the arms in front of the body with palms down. The head is tilted down with the chin is close as possible to the pit above the breastbone.
Breathing in, straighten up and align your pelvis and lower spine. Firm your belly and one leg including the buttock – this will be your standing leg.
